The Impact of Burn Injuries
Burns are classified into three degrees, which include the following:
- First-Degree: Also known as superficial burns, these only affect the outer layer of skin
- Second-Degree: Partial thickness, or second-degree, burns penetrate part of the dermis layer of the skinย
- Third-Degree: Also known as full-thickness burns, third-degree burns damage all layers of the dermis and epidermis
Burns can result in a wide range of serious health conditions and a long, painful healing process. Even a minor burn can take around two weeks to heal. If the burn is more severe, you may have to undergo treatment at a specialized facility.
Obtaining Medical Treatment for Burns
Most well-equipped medical facilities can treat minor burns. If you suffer a first-degree burn injury, you can seek treatment at the nearest facility, such as Lawrence County Memorial Hospital. However, if you suffer a more severe burn, you will need to go to a specialized facility, such as the Walter L. Ingram Burn Center.
Treatment for severe burns can take months to complete. The process involves incredibly painful procedures like debridement, where medical professionals must carefully remove layers of dead or damaged skin from the affected area.
Between having to travel to a specialized facility and the need for prolonged, ongoing treatments, a burn can upend your life and place a huge financial burden on your family. Potential Compensation in Burn Injury Cases
The compensation you may be entitled to will vary depending on the severity of your injuries and the impact on your life. In Georgia, compensation is typically divided into two categories โ economic and non-economic.
Economic compensation includes any measurable losses. For example, your medical bills, rehab costs, and lost wages will all fall under the โeconomicโ side of compensation.
You may also be entitled to non-economic damages, which canโt be measured but still have a negative impact on your life. Pain and suffering, emotional distress, and loss of enjoyment of life are the most common examples of non-economic damages.
